Imagine facing two felonies, three DUIs, and a devastating custody battle. For Natalie Calkins Rountree, this was her reality after 15 years of heavy drinking. In this episode of 'The Recovery Revolution', Natalie opens up about hitting rock bottom and the spiritual awakening that transformed her life. She talks candidly about the legal struggles, the impact of addiction on her relationships, and the long road to getting her daughter back.
Now, with eight years of sobriety under her belt, Natalie lives a life she once thought impossible. She shares her journey of self-forgiveness, self-love, and finding inner peace. As the founder of Sober Living Soulful Living, Natalie aims to inspire others to not just recover but to thrive. She discusses the importance of spirituality in her recovery and the challenges and rewards of sober living.
